Prayer for Grandparents
"Gray hair is a crown of splendor; it is attained in the way of righteousness." — Proverbs 16:31
Grandparents carry a special anointing — they have walked the road longer, seen God's faithfulness across decades, and hold a unique place in family legacy. This prayer honors them and covers them with blessing, health, and the grace to finish strong. Whether you are a grandparent praying for yourself or a child praying for your grandparents, speak these words in faith.
A Prayer for Grandparents
Father God, in the name of Jesus, I thank You for grandparents. I thank You for their wisdom, their legacy, and the foundation of faith they have laid. Today I plead the precious blood of Jesus over grandparents — over their health, over their minds, over their spirits, and over their latter years.
I pray for their health and strength. Renew their youth like the eagle's. Strengthen their bodies for the days ahead. Let them not grow weary in well-doing.
I pray for their legacy. Let every seed of faith they have planted bear fruit for generations. Let their latter years be greater than their former. Let them see the fruit of their labor in their children and grandchildren.
I pray for their joy. Let them enjoy the fruit of their labor. Let them rest in the knowledge that they have run their race well. Surround them with love and honor.
I love You. I honor You. I give You all the glory. In the mighty name of Jesus, I pray. Amen.

Key Scriptures
- • Proverbs 16:31 — "Gray hair is a crown of splendor; it is attained in the way of righteousness."
- • Psalm 92:14 — "They will still bear fruit in old age, they will stay fresh and green."
- • Isaiah 46:4 — "Even to your old age and gray hairs I am He, I am He who will sustain you."
- • Proverbs 20:29 — "The glory of young men is their strength, gray hair the splendor of the old."
